PennyMac Financial Services Gears Up for Earnings Amidst Challenging Mortgage Landscape
PennyMac Financial Services Inc. (PFSI) prepares to release its quarterly earnings on July 22, 2025, and market experts are closely monitoring the anticipated results. As the company navigates a tumultuous mortgage environment characterized by fluctuating interest rates and shifting housing demand, analysts predict a significant year-over-year decline in net income. Estimates suggest PFSI may report a net income of approximately $120 million for the quarter, with earnings per share (EPS) expected to hover around $1.00, reflecting the impact of a competitive market landscape. This downturn is indicative of the broader trends affecting the mortgage sector, where companies are adjusting to evolving economic conditions.
Key performance indicators such as loan origination volume and servicing portfolio growth are crucial focal points for investors. Analysts forecast that PFSI’s loan origination volume may drop to $4 billion, down from $5.2 billion in the same quarter last year. This projected decline highlights the struggles PFSI faces in an environment of rising interest rates and tightening credit conditions, which have made it more challenging for borrowers to secure loans. However, the servicing segment appears to present a silver lining, with expectations that PFSI’s servicing portfolio will surpass $500 billion. This substantial portfolio could serve as a stable revenue stream, mitigating some of the adverse effects of reduced origination activity.

In related developments, PennyMac Mortgage Investment Trust (PMT) is also set to announce its quarterly earnings on the same date, July 22, 2025. Analysts project PMT will report an EPS of around $0.58, potentially reflecting a year-over-year increase, indicating robust mortgage origination and servicing activity. The market is particularly attentive to PMT’s net interest income, expected to be approximately $120 million, as the company enhances its operational efficiency and focuses on expanding into new markets.
